If you’ve ever enjoyed puzzle-solving or loved spy thrillers, the Downfall Spy Mission offers a unique twist on the typical escape room experience. Located in Copenhagen, Denmark, this private adventure runs about 2 hours 30 minutes, with a price of roughly $467 for up to six people. It’s a premium, tailor-made escape game that blends live actors, cutting-edge technology, and authentic 1989 Soviet-era scenography into one gripping story—acting as a spy team trying to prevent World War III.

The Setting and Storyline

Imagine stepping into 1989, behind the Cold War borders of the Soviet Union. You and your team are agents tasked with stopping a crisis that could lead to World War III. The authentic scenography transports you right into a Cold War spy film, with period-specific decor, props, and an immersive atmosphere. The sound system, with 34 hidden speakers, heightens tension as you piece together clues amid subtle background noises and suspenseful music.

Live Actor Involvement

One of the most praised features is the presence of a live actor, who plays a significant role in the scene. Ada, for example, was lauded for her convincing performance, adding layers of authenticity and fun. The actor interacts with your team, providing hints, creating tension, and even injecting humor, which keeps the energy high and engagement personal.

Is this experience suitable for children?
Children must be accompanied by an adult, and since the game is immersive and story-driven, it’s best for kids who enjoy puzzles and stories, but check in advance if you’re concerned about age restrictions.

How long does the entire experience last?
The main game itself is about 2 hours and 30 minutes, including introduction and wrap-up, totaling roughly 2.5 to 3 hours.

What is included in the price?
Your group gets a private escape room, a dedicated guide or game master, and photos of your team after completing the mission.

Are alcoholic drinks included?
No, drinks are available for purchase separately. There is no alcohol included in the experience fee.

Where do we meet?
The starting point is at Aldersrogade 6A, 2100 København, which is conveniently near public transportation.

Can I change or cancel my booking?
This experience is non-refundable and cannot be changed once booked, so be sure of your schedule before reserving.
